Troubling rate of Caesarean sections around the world – Report
Caesarean sections around the world are rising at a rapid rate, according to a report by an international team of doctors and scientists. Singapore Airlines executes world's longest ever non-stop flight
Singapore Airlines has executed the world’s longest ever non-stop flight after it completed its direct service between Singapore and New York on Friday. Singapore Airlines Airbus A350-900ULR took off Thursday from Changi Airport on its way to Newark Liberty International Airport, and covered the 9,000 nautical miles (9,537 miles) in 17 hours and 25 minutes.
